Looking For Alaska By: John Green Alexandra Mitchell

A is for Alaska Alaska was the girl that Miles liked. She broke a lot of rules and she liked to pull pranks on people to get revenge.

B is for Boarding School Miles left his family to go to a boarding school called Culver Creek.

C is for Chip Chip was Miles’ best friend and also his roommate. He also helps Alaska plan a prank to get revenge.

D is for Duct Tape Duct tape is what Miles was tied up in before he got thrown in the lake.

E is for Eagle The Eagle ran Culver Creek. They called him the Eagle because he always caught someone breaking the rules.

F is for Fox While Takumi and Miles were pulling the prank on the Eagle, Takumi pretended he was a fox in the woods because he was wearing his favorite fox hat.

G is for Greif After Alaska’s funeral Miles, Chip, Takumi and Lara all felt grief.

H is for Hair gel After Miles was pushed into the lake Alaska, Chip, and Takumi plan a prank to put blue dye in all of the suspects hair gel.

I is for incredible After Alaska’s funeral all of her friends talked about how she was an incredible friend.

J is for Jake Jake was Alaska’s boyfriend who Miles hated because he really liked Alaska.

K is for Kevin Kevin was the boy who tied Miles up in duct tape and threw him in the pond.

L is for Lara Lara was the girl that Miles threw up on after he hit his head and got concussion. She is also his girlfriend and Russian.

M is for Miles Miles is the main character. He likes to memorize famous peoples last words.

N is for Notebook Miles wrote down all the memories he had with Alaska in his notebook so he would always remember them.

O is for Outstanding Miles thought that Alaska was an outstanding person and he really liked her.

P is Prank Miles, Alaska, Chip, and Takumi plan a prank to get revenge on kids that almost killed Miles.

Q is for Quiz When Miles was doing a quiz during class he started day dreaming and his teacher kicked him out of class.

R is for “Regulars” Chip named two groups of kids at Culver Creek. The regulars were like him and Miles who weren’t rich and snobby.

S is for Suffering After Alaska’s death Miles suffered from being sad.

T is for Takumi Takumi is also one of Miles best friends and he helped him pull off the prank.

U is for underwear When Miles got pushed into the lake he was in his underwear.

V is for Vomit After Miles got a concussion he accidentally puked on Lara but she still liked him after.

W is for Weekday Warriors The Weekday Warriors were the group of rich snobby kids. Chip also came up with the name for them.

X is for Explosion During the prank Takumi and Miles set off an explosion to distract the Eagle.

Y is for Yellow Alaska’s favorite color was yellow.

Z is for Zero Alaska had zero tolerance for anyone.
